The Director Project Procurement / Supply Chain and Quality will be responsible for developing the supply chain strategy optimization and execution for the overall Emissions Solutions business leading and directing all facets of supply chain management including but not limited to purchasing global logistics (domestic & international) supplier rationalization inventory management spend management material forecasting capacity planning and sourcing master scheduling contract negotiations and long term agreements ERP implementation low cost country sourcing product cost reduction continuous improvement while at the same time improve service levels reduce operational cost develop quality standards and ensure products processes and manufactured goods meet the desired quality expectations of various stakeholders . Designs and executes strategies and plans to meet companys short-term and long-term supply chain management/production control requirements.

Your Responsibilities Will Be:

  • Provide hands-on tactical leadership to ensure a world class supply chain which supports forecasted sales growth maximizes operating savings delivers on time and below budget meets set quality expectations participates in product development and ensures customer satisfaction.
  • Implementing global sourcing strategies including low-cost country sourcing supplier audit and selection negotiations and scorecards.
  • Leads procurement of subcontracted goods and services from developing RFP/RFQ strategic supplier selection based on total cost of ownership bid tab analysis supplier & risk management
  • Provide leadership and guidance to Procurement and QA/QC/SQE team to achieve desired goals and objectives ensure timely procurement within budget and delivered early or on time.
  • Establish metrics goals checks and balances to measure and improve performance in the areas of purchasing planning inventory levels and on-time delivery.
  • Set a collaborative tone within the department and across the organization insisting on working in partnership to achieve results.
  • Review supplier capacity and lead expansion of supplier capacity including but not limited to developing new supply sources internationally negotiate long term capacity agreements increasing shop capacity via added resources multiple shifts increased floor space etc.
  • Proactively work cross-functionally with all departments to drive new product launches and ensure proper supplier and component selection.
  • Improve supplier net payment terms and milestone payments to ensure positive cash flow on projects manage subcontractor progress to meet business goals for revenue.
  • Evaluate and implement new processes systems and technology to drive improvement in products and fabrication capacity utilization and synchronization of supply and demand to reduce total supply chain costs and working capital while meeting service goals.
  • Improve operational efficiency & quality within and outside the organization by resolving production issues resolving NCR/CCARs perform RCA and using lean techniques such as process mapping line balancing value stream mapping manufacturing engineering poka-yoke etc.
  • Design quality network to verify products & manufacturing meet desired quality develop supplier quality hold suppliers accountable for Non-conforming goods facility RCA to avoid reoccurrence.
  • Develop work instructions procedures and standards to streamline and create sustainable and reliable supply chain with adequate controls checks and balances.
  • Evaluate manage and constantly mitigate or transfer supply chain risk for noncompliance to customer requirements lead times cost overruns shortages errors & omissions supplier financial health safety environmental & industry code violations and compliance to laws and regulations of respective countries the US and CECOs code of conduct.
  • Develop business processes which will improve overall supply chain performance while satisfying current demands and minimizing total supply chain costs.
  • Build and maintain strong relationships throughout the supply chain from suppliers to customers and negotiate implement and maintain supply contracts when deemed necessary; responsible for all purchasing activities and develop strategies to maximize customer service when supply disruptions or shortages are anticipated.
  • Financially responsible for departmental budgets material standard costs and inventory forecasts while ensuring performance to budget.
  • Ensure compliance with all Federal State Local and company regulations policies and procedures for Health Safety and Environmental compliance.
  • Proven ability to analyze and plan manufacturing and supplier activity to meet customer requirements while minimizing inventory investment and total supply chain costs.
  • Other job duties as assigned.

Required Qualifications:

  • Bachelors degree in industrial engineering or supply chain management or engineering from an accredited institution.
  • A masters degree in industrial engineering Supply Chain or Business Administration desired.
  • Professional Certification in CPIM or CSCP/APICS required.
  • 10 years supply chain leadership experience.
  • 5 years experience in various supply chain functions such as sourcing negotiations logistics warehouse management or procurement.
  • 5 years of experience in Lean Manufacturing Continuous Improvement Operational improvement
  • Knowledge and / or experience in Six Sigma Lean Kaizen Continuous Improvement line balancing cost methods poka yoke kanban material handling and facility improvements.
  • Financial knowledge of P&L ROI Invoicing & cash flow Percentage of completion
  • Knowledge of supply chain cost drivers that affect performance (lead times inventory drivers transportations costs market volatility in commodities geopolitical impacts and material and product cost drivers).
  • Strong leadership communication decision making and interpersonal skills are required.
  • Ability to manage projects and tasks in parallel.
  • The ability to think strategically but also is pragmatic and customer focused to ensure implementation effectiveness
